Grenadiers Get Past IU Kokomo 4-3 In Season Opener

NEW ALBANY, Ind. - The IU Southeast women's tennis team defeated IU Kokomo 4-3 on Friday afternoon. In their first action since the start of the COVID-19 pandemic the Grenadiers had to fight hard in order to pull out the 4-3 victory.

"We had a lot of players playing their first collegiate match today and considering most of our girls haven't played a competitive match outside of practice I was pleased with the result. We definitely had some nerves to overcome but in the end we were able to settle down and come out with the win." head coach Joe Epkey said.

After winning No. 1 doubles and dropping the No. 2 position the doubles point would be decided at No. 3. The Grenadiers' pairing of Katie Weimer and Kate Heuchan led 5-3 but were unable to hold on dropping the match and losing the doubles point.

Down 1-0 heading into singles play IU Southeast picked up 3 singles wins in straight sets but lost 2 positions which tied the match at 3-3. Junior Hallee Miller came up big for the Grenadiers after dropping her first set 6-3 she was able to keep her composure and clinch the team win with a 6-3, 6-2 comeback in the final two sets.

Audrey De Witt, Anna Littlefield and Katie Weimer each earned their first collegiate singles win on Friday to cap off a successful debut for the young Grenadiers in the lineup.

Next up for the Grenadiers, they travel to Indiana Wesleyan Sept 18th and 19th for a tournament.
